How they compare
Guyana currently reports 0.5822 % change on previous year against 0.5449 % change on previous year in Trinidad and Tobago, a difference of 0.0373 % change on previous year.
That makes Guyana's figure about 1.1 times Trinidad and Tobago's.
The two have swapped places 12 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Guyana ahead.
Guyana ranks 39th and Trinidad and Tobago ranks 42nd of 170 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Guyana averaged higher in 2 and Trinidad and Tobago in 1.
